power: reset: at91-poweroff: timely shutdown LPDDR memories



commit 0b0408745e7ff24757cbfd571d69026c0ddb803c upstream.

LPDDR memories can only handle up to 400 uncontrolled power off. Ensure the
proper power off sequence is used before shutting down the platform.
